Water distribution causes many issues in Africa. The majority of fresh water in Africa is used for agriculture or farming.
In the 21st century, water scarcity is one of the main issues faced by African countries.
The continent of Africa is facing the worst water shortages according to the World Health Organization (WHO) reports.
The main reasons behind the water shortage in Africa are the growing population, climate changes, and economic scarcity.
According to WHO, only 1 out of 3 people have access to fresh and portable water while other people are lacking freshwater resources and the situation is worsening with each passing day.
In general, the major reason for water issues is the inadequate distribution of water resources such as lakes and rivers.
In Africa, almost every lake and river is divided between two or more countries and rapid population growth over years is compounding the water crisis.
